Pats are DIIIIGGGGGIN IN:kraft posted:What is not highlighted in the text of the report is that three of the Colts’ four footballs measured by at least one official were under the required psi level. As far as we are aware, there is no comparable data available from any other game because, in the history of the NFL, psi levels of footballs have never been measured at halftime, in any climate. If they had been, based on what we now know, it is safe to assume that every cold-weather game was played with under inflated footballs. As compelling a case as the Wells Report may try to make, I am going to rely on the factual evidence of numerous scientists and engineers rather than inferences from circumstantial evidence. link sorry: http://www.patriots.com/news/2015/05/06/statement-new-england-patriots-chairman-and-ceo-robert-kraft-wells-report
